Wednesday Scorecard: The Masked Singer's Disappointing Performance on Fox (2026)

The Masked Singer's performance on Fox on Wednesday was underwhelming, with a 1.45/5 rating, marking a decline from its previous performance. The show's ratings have been on a downward trend, with a 1.41/5 rating for the 8:00 PM slot, a 1.46/5 rating for the 8:30 PM slot, and a 1.42/5 rating for the 9:00 PM slot. The competition was fierce, with Chicago Med on NBC leading the 8:00 PM slot with a 3.30/11 rating, and Chicago Fire on NBC closely following with a 2.91/10 rating. The 9:00 PM slot saw a similar trend, with Chicago Fire on NBC maintaining its lead with a 2.87/10 rating, and Chicago Med on NBC not far behind with a 2.89/10 rating. The competition was intense, with ABC's Shark Tank and CBS's Hollywood Squares also vying for viewers' attention. However, The Masked Singer's performance was not enough to compete with the strong ratings of its competitors, indicating a need for a strategic reevaluation of the show's approach to maintain its audience.
